Bali, 1 May 2026 – The atmosphere at The Westin Resort Nusa Dua reflected the growing urgency among Indonesia’s HR community in navigating a new era of technological transformation. Around 200 senior HR leaders and business executives gathered for two days at the HR Directors Indonesia Summit 2026 on April 29–30, 2026, to discuss a shared challenge facing organizations today: how to lead HR functions amid rapidly evolving technology.
Carrying the theme “Redefining HR Leadership in a Tech-Driven Age”, the summit served as a strategic platform for HR decision-makers across Indonesia. DataOn participated as a sponsor through its flagship solution, SunFish HR, which became one of the key discussion points throughout the event.

One of the most anticipated sessions came from Frenky Pranata, who delivered a presentation titled “From HR Data to HR Decisions: Making People Analytics Work in Daily HR Operations.” During the session, Frenky emphasized that the main challenge organizations face today is no longer the lack of data, but how to turn that data into consistent and actionable HR decisions in day-to-day operations.

During these conversations, the DataOn team also invited participants to reflect on a question closely aligned with the summit’s broader theme: what leadership capabilities can never be replaced by AI?
Most participants agreed that capabilities such as influence, stakeholder management, mentoring, coaching, and empathetic people management remain fundamentally human. While AI can help HR teams process and present data faster and more accurately, building trust, influencing stakeholders, and shaping organizational culture still require human connection.
Participants also emphasized that HR today is no longer merely an operational function, but a strategic one responsible for building and sustaining company culture. And according to many attendees, culture is something that cannot simply be created through algorithms.
